Atelier Capital Partners makes four senior hires




Short-term lender Atelier Capital Partners has announced four senior hires to its credit and risk team.

Alan MacLeod, Matthew Measures and Anthony Dobinson have been appointed to senior investment manager roles.

The fourth hire is Samantha Londerville as an investment manager; she has joined from Laurentian Bank of Canada, where she was a credit analyst.

Alan was previously a senior credit manager of real estate finance at Santander and Matthew was head of loan analysis at Hampshire Trust Bank.

Anthony was most recently at Wellesley Group as head of credit operations.

Atelier launched in January 2020 and offers a range of short-term and development finance solutions of up to 24 months to professional SME residential developers and property companies.

Graham Emmett, chief investment officer at Atelier Capital Partners (pictured above), commented: “Despite these extraordinary times, we are confident that demand from developers will return once the lockdown measures are eased and they can get back to work in earnest.

Atelier has continued with its planned hires over the past two months, and Graham was pleased to welcome the new recruits onboard.

“While we expect uncertainty and flux in the short-term, there is one constant in the UK property market — and that is the supply deficit and the need to build homes. 

“To that end, we have put in place structures to enable our existing borrowers to access funds and continue to build and are open for new loan business.”
